About Us

The American Red Cross prevents and alleviates human suffering in the face of emergencies by mobilizing the power of volunteers and the generosity of donors.

Whether helping one displaced family or thousands, providing care and comfort to an ill or injured service member or veteran, or teaching others how to respond in emergencies, it’s through the efforts of ordinary people that we can do extraordinary things.

Good To Know:

  • Volunteers and interns carry out over 90% of the humanitarian work of the Red Cross.
  • We respond to nearly 64,000 disasters a year
  • 25% of volunteers are aged 24 or younger
